

Holiday Inn Express Málaga Airport, an IHG Hotel Overview
First Impressions
The Holiday Inn Express Málaga Airport, an IHG Hotel sits right where you need it — literally three minutes from the airport terminals, which honestly makes all the difference when you’re dealing with early flights or late arrivals. I mean, you can actually see planes taking off from some of the windows, but surprisingly, the soundproofing keeps things pretty quiet. The building itself is modern and clean, nothing fancy but definitely more polished than your typical airport hotel.
Location & Getting Around
Here’s what I really appreciated about the location — yes, it’s in Churriana rather than central Málaga, but that’s actually not a bad thing. You’re about 15 minutes by car to the city center, and the hotel provides free private parking which is honestly a godsend in this part of Spain. The MA-21 road connection means you can easily reach the beaches at Torremolinos or even venture into the mountains if you’ve got a rental car. Plus, there’s a decent supermarket within walking distance, which comes in handy.
The Room Experience
The room I stayed in was exactly what you’d expect from a three-star Holiday Inn Express — clean, functional, and surprisingly comfortable. The bed was actually really good (I’m picky about mattresses), and the air conditioning worked perfectly, which you definitely need during Málaga summers. The bathroom was compact but well-designed, with a proper shower that had decent water pressure. What I liked most was the blackout curtains — they actually block out light completely, so you can sleep in even with all that Mediterranean sunshine.
Breakfast & Dining
The breakfast buffet here is honestly better than I expected for an airport hotel. They’ve got the usual continental spread, but also some local touches like proper Spanish ham and decent coffee — not the watery stuff you sometimes get at chain hotels. The restaurant area gets busy around 7 AM with business travelers, so I’d suggest going either earlier or after 8:30 if you prefer a quieter meal. They also keep it running until 10 AM, which gives you flexibility if you’re not an early riser.
